Output 0663d2eb3d036e9c0b2ee7cc583756a6dcc2a40a5605b5ee58fdabe778eb006e:1

value
408900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9ecb1f4a4e4037a6d86cb7bf31122b45d004b1 OP_EQUAL
address
3G9iv1poWYVMFVHRP8vpRKEcmyk6rrUx8B
transaction
0663d2eb3d036e9c0b2ee7cc583756a6dcc2a40a5605b5ee58fdabe778eb006e
confirmations
178758
spent
true